多因素身份验证-OneLogin

多因素身份验证-OneLogin

专用API
服务商 服务商: OneLogin
【更新时间: 2024.08.02】 OneLogin 的多因素身份验证API 是另一个简单易用的 API,它仍然具有足够的可定制性,可用于各种不同的应用程序。OneLogin 与其他 MFA API 的区别在于,它能够将用户登录到通过“会话创建”功能...
服务星级:2星
⭐ ⭐ 🌟 🌟 🌟 🌟 🌟
调用次数
0
集成人数
0
商用人数
0
! SLA: N/A
! 响应: N/A
! 适用于个人&企业
收藏
×
完成
取消
×
书签名称
确定
<
产品介绍
>

什么是OneLogin的多因素身份验证?

OneLogin 多因素身份验证API是一种安全工具,旨在通过添加额外的验证步骤来增强用户身份验证过程。这意味着除了输入用户名和密码外,用户还需要提供第二种形式的身份验证,比如短信验证码、电子邮件链接、推送通知或TOTP。

什么是OneLogin的多因素身份验证?

由服务使用方的应用程序发起,以Restful风格为主、通过公网HTTP协议调用OneLogin的多因素身份验证,从而实现程序的自动化交互,提高服务效率。

OneLogin的多因素身份验证有哪些核心功能?

  1. 获取可用的身份验证因素:用户注册的身份验证因素列表。
  2. 注册身份验证因素:注册具有给定身份验证因素的用户。
  3. 获取注册的身份验证因素:为多重身份验证 (MFA) 注册到特定用户的身份验证因素列表。该列表包括已启用(至少成功用于身份验证一次)或待启用(已注册但从未使用)的设备。
  4. 激活身份验证因素:触发包含一次性密码 (OTP) 的 SMS 或推送通知,该一次性密码可用于通过验证因素调用对用户进行身份验证。
  5. 验证身份验证因素:对多重身份验证 (MFA) 设备提供的一次性密码 (OTP) 代码进行身份验证。

OneLogin的多因素身份验证的核心优势是什么?

 

  1. 增强安全性:通过多因素身份验证,有效防止未经授权的访问,提高企业系统的整体安全性。
  2. 用户友好性:支持多种验证方式,用户可以选择最方便的方式进行验证,从而提高用户满意度。
  3. 灵活性和兼容性:可以无缝集成到现有系统中,无需大规模改动现有基础设施。
  4. 实时性:提供即时的验证反馈,确保用户登录过程的流畅和安全。
  5. 可管理性:详细的验证日志和报告功能,帮助管理员及时发现和处理潜在的安全威胁。

 

在哪些场景会用到OneLogin的多因素身份验证?

企业内部系统访问:在大型企业中,员工访问公司内部系统时需要更高的安全性,OneLogin 多因素身份验证API可以确保只有经过多重验证的员工才能访问重要资源,从而防止内部数据泄露。

 

在线服务平台:对于需要保护用户账户信息的在线服务平台,比如电子邮件服务、社交媒体或云存储服务,OneLogin 多因素身份验证API可以为用户提供额外的安全保障,防止账户被盗用。

 

 

 

 

<
使用指南
>

示例

获取可用的身份验证因素

https://<subdomain>/api/1/users/<user_id>/auth_factors

 标头参数

Authorization 设置为bearer:<access_token> 。
required <access_token>设置为您使用生成令牌API 生成的访问令牌。
string 访问令牌必须是使用API 凭据对生成的,该 API 凭据对是使用调用此 API 所需的范围创建的。可以使用以下任一范围调用此 API: Read Users 、 Manage users 、 Read AllManage All 。

 资源参数

user_id 设置为用户的id 。
required 如果您不知道用户的id ,请使用获取用户API 调用返回所有用户及其id值。
integer  

 响应样本:

{
    "status": {
        "error": false,
        "code": 200,
        "type": "success",
        "message": "Success"
    },
    "data": {
        "auth_factors": [
            {
                "name": "OneLogin SMS",
                "factor_id": 16282
            }
        ]
    }
}

详情参考:https://developers.onelogin.com/api-docs/1/multi-factor-authentication/enroll-factor

 

 

<
产品问答
>
?
OneLogin 的多因素身份验证 (MFA) 是什么?
OneLogin 的多因素身份验证 (MFA) 增加了一层额外的安全性,要求用户在访问账户前提供多种形式的身份验证。这可以包括用户知道的东西(如密码)、用户拥有的东西(如移动设备)或用户本身的特征(如指纹)。
?
OneLogin 的 MFA 支持哪些身份验证方法?
OneLogin 的 MFA 支持多种身份验证方法,包括: 推送通知 SMS 短信 电子邮件 语音呼叫 TOTP(基于时间的一次性密码) U2F(通用第二因素,如硬件安全密钥) 生物特征验证(如指纹或面部识别)OneLogin 的 MFA 支持多种身份验证方法,包括: 推送通知 SMS 短信 电子邮件 语音呼叫 TOTP(基于时间的一次性密码) U2F(通用第二因素,如硬件安全密钥) 生物特征验证(如指纹或面部识别)
?
如何在 OneLogin 中设置多因素身份验证 (MFA)?
要在 OneLogin 中设置多因素身份验证 (MFA),请按照以下步骤操作: 登录到 OneLogin 管理控制台。 导航到用户管理或安全设置。 启用多因素身份验证并选择所需的身份验证方法。 用户将在下次登录时被提示设置其 MFA 设备,如手机应用或安全密钥。 完成设置后,用户需要使用所选的 MFA 方法进行身份验证。
<
关于我们
>
OneLogin
企业
OneLogin是一家领先的全球身份和访问管理解决方案提供商,致力于保护企业的工作力、客户和合作伙伴数据。公司提供全面的云基础访问管理平台,包括单点登录、多因素认证、高级目录服务等。OneLogin支持6000多种应用集成,帮助企业实现快速部署和高效运营,同时通过智能风险评估和自适应认证强化安全防护。其解决方案广受超过5500家全球客户信赖,包括BIC Graphics、Broward College等知名企业。OneLogin不断推动技术创新,致力于为客户提供更安全、更高效的访问管理体验。
联系信息
服务时间: 00:00:00至24:00:00
网页在线客服: 咨询

<
最可能同场景使用的其他API
>
API接口列表
<
使用指南
>

示例

获取可用的身份验证因素

https://<subdomain>/api/1/users/<user_id>/auth_factors

 标头参数

Authorization 设置为bearer:<access_token> 。
required <access_token>设置为您使用生成令牌API 生成的访问令牌。
string 访问令牌必须是使用API 凭据对生成的,该 API 凭据对是使用调用此 API 所需的范围创建的。可以使用以下任一范围调用此 API: Read Users 、 Manage users 、 Read AllManage All 。

 资源参数

user_id 设置为用户的id 。
required 如果您不知道用户的id ,请使用获取用户API 调用返回所有用户及其id值。
integer  

 响应样本:

{
    "status": {
        "error": false,
        "code": 200,
        "type": "success",
        "message": "Success"
    },
    "data": {
        "auth_factors": [
            {
                "name": "OneLogin SMS",
                "factor_id": 16282
            }
        ]
    }
}

详情参考:https://developers.onelogin.com/api-docs/1/multi-factor-authentication/enroll-factor

 

 

<
依赖服务
>
<
产品问答
>
?
OneLogin 的多因素身份验证 (MFA) 是什么?
OneLogin 的多因素身份验证 (MFA) 增加了一层额外的安全性,要求用户在访问账户前提供多种形式的身份验证。这可以包括用户知道的东西(如密码)、用户拥有的东西(如移动设备)或用户本身的特征(如指纹)。
?
OneLogin 的 MFA 支持哪些身份验证方法?
OneLogin 的 MFA 支持多种身份验证方法,包括: 推送通知 SMS 短信 电子邮件 语音呼叫 TOTP(基于时间的一次性密码) U2F(通用第二因素,如硬件安全密钥) 生物特征验证(如指纹或面部识别)OneLogin 的 MFA 支持多种身份验证方法,包括: 推送通知 SMS 短信 电子邮件 语音呼叫 TOTP(基于时间的一次性密码) U2F(通用第二因素,如硬件安全密钥) 生物特征验证(如指纹或面部识别)
?
如何在 OneLogin 中设置多因素身份验证 (MFA)?
要在 OneLogin 中设置多因素身份验证 (MFA),请按照以下步骤操作: 登录到 OneLogin 管理控制台。 导航到用户管理或安全设置。 启用多因素身份验证并选择所需的身份验证方法。 用户将在下次登录时被提示设置其 MFA 设备,如手机应用或安全密钥。 完成设置后,用户需要使用所选的 MFA 方法进行身份验证。
<
关于我们
>
OneLogin
企业
OneLogin是一家领先的全球身份和访问管理解决方案提供商,致力于保护企业的工作力、客户和合作伙伴数据。公司提供全面的云基础访问管理平台,包括单点登录、多因素认证、高级目录服务等。OneLogin支持6000多种应用集成,帮助企业实现快速部署和高效运营,同时通过智能风险评估和自适应认证强化安全防护。其解决方案广受超过5500家全球客户信赖,包括BIC Graphics、Broward College等知名企业。OneLogin不断推动技术创新,致力于为客户提供更安全、更高效的访问管理体验。
联系信息
服务时间: 00:00:00至24:00:00
网页在线客服: 咨询

<
最可能同场景使用的其他API
>